The invention discloses a torque limiting method, system and device based on friction force calculation. The torque limiting method comprises the steps that all influence factor information related to oil cylinder friction force is analyzed through an oil cylinder test sample in the whole working condition range of a whole machine; all influence factor information related to the oil cylinder friction force is imported into an oil cylinder friction force calculation model, an oil cylinder friction force numerical value is obtained, and meanwhile other friction force numerical values with the three-hinge-point friction force as the main component are obtained; the oil cylinder friction force value and other friction force values with the three-hinge-point friction force as the main component are substituted into a moment balance formula, the load weight is obtained and judged, whether the moment load output by the crane exceeds the limit or not is determined, and a corresponding safety warning signal is output according to the judgment result; according to the method, a high-precision friction force value is obtained through a high-precision calculation model of the friction force of the oil cylinder and a parameter calibration mode under multiple working conditions, and it is guaranteed that the torque limiting system accurately weighs the load and outputs corresponding safety alarm information based on the weighing result.
